#1f1f78 basic color information

#1f1f78

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1f1f78 has decimal index of: 2039672, is composed of 12.2% red, 12.2% green and 47.1% blue. #1f1f78 in CMYK color model, is composed of 74.2% cyan, 74.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black.
#333366 is the closest web-safe color to #1f1f78.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
